The official newspaper of the Chinese Communist Party has announced that the recent allegations of Chinese-based hacks were politically motivated to start disputes with the United States.
Google came out last week saying that hackers from the Shandong province of Eastern China tried to compromise the Gmail accounts of some senior US officials. The attempted hackings were said to have been attempts to trick the officials to disclose their passwords.
The accusation of attacks is just the latest in a series of statements from Google and China. The rift between Google and China has been expanding ever since the company refused to censor certain search results in China.
